What is the matter?

Recently, this unique product is being discussed a lot on social media. It is being claimed that this will be the world's first protein condom, which will not only provide protection but will also help in improving performance. As strange as it sounds, it has quickly gone viral on the internet. This product is being associated with fitness influencer and YouTuber Gorav Taneja i.e. Flying Beast. His fitness brand Beastlife claims to have introduced it. Recently, a glimpse of this product was shown in an Instagram post, in which it was written “Protein goodness coming soon”. After this, the teaser of “world's first protein condom” came out, which further increased people's curiosity.

Now the question is, is this a protein condom after all?

According to reports, an amino acid named L-Arginine has been used in it, which is known to increase blood flow in the body. It is being claimed that this will lead to better circulation and may improve performance. However, no concrete scientific evidence has yet emerged regarding this claim. Another special thing about this product is that it can be launched in different flavours, chocolate, strawberry and vanilla. However, it is not yet clear whether it will actually come in the market or is just a marketing strategy.

people's reaction

People's reactions to this news on the internet are no less interesting. Some people are considering it a joke, while some are calling it an April Fool's prank. At the same time, many users made a funny comment and asked, “Is this pre-workout or post-workout?” At present, official confirmation regarding this product is awaited. But it is certain that it has attracted people's attention and has started a new debate whether such products can really increase performance or is it just a marketing game.
